// If we found the DB but not the collection, the collection might exist and not be
// sharded, so send the command to the primary shard.
- _dropUnshardedCollectionFromShard(
- opCtx, dbStatus.getValue().value.getPrimary(), nss, &result);
+ try {
+ _dropUnshardedCollectionFromShard(
+ opCtx, dbStatus.getValue().value.getPrimary(), nss, &result);
+ } catch (const ExceptionForCat<ErrorCategory::StaleShardVersionError>& ex) {
+ // If attempting to drop the collection as unsharded fails due to stale shard
+ // version, this means that the collection became sharded after this drop operation
+ // started. With the distributed lock in place, this can only happen if the lock was
+ // overtaken or metadata is manually tampered with. Since retrying the drop at this
+ // point could potentially cause orphaned chunk data to remain, instead of retrying
+ // just fail the drop.
+ uassertStatusOKWithContext(
+ Status(ErrorCodes::ConflictingOperationInProgress,
+ str::stream()
+ << "Collection "
+ << nss.ns()
+ << " became sharded while the drop operation was in progress."),
+ ex.toString());
+ }
